If the incident state is 'In Progress', then make the assignment group and assignee fields mandatory in both the list view and the form in Incident table i.e in the list view state field can not be updated without providing assignment group and assigned to.

Hi @AnilJ
In list view until a user click on that record to update the logic will not work. You can write oncell edit script and in that you need to check
- Is Assignment group is not empty
- Is assigned to is member of assignment group

To apply this to the list view as well, you can create a data policy (and apply it as ui policy as well). You can't update a record in the list if the data policy makes fields mandatory.
